Just the one that I can use as it's the only one I have strips for. I get one on prescription every 4 years and they are expensive to buy here.
At the moment fed up with my 'new' BG Star. I'm about to go for a run and it just told me I was 65 (too low) and then a repeat test said 96 (Ok ish), the third 102 .(it's not the first time I've had very inconsistent results with it)
As I can't have a new one for some time,I'm going to ask my doctor to go back to prescribing for my now 5 year old One Touch.
